The Oklahoma City Thunder were looking to get a huge series-evening win at home against the Houston Rockets, but were essentially cheated out of the game at the end. Down two with under 10 seconds remaining, the Rockets had to inbound the ball and star guard James Harden clearly two-hand shoved Alex Abrines in order to get open.

That was a pretty clear offensive foul, but of course it went uncalled because NBA refs either choose not to see these fouls or don't care enough to call them. The non-call forced Russell Westbrook to foul Eric Gordon who made both of his free throws to make it a 113-109 win for the Rockets.
